Food and Nutrition

Meals are a shared experience, where the children come together to eat and chat about their day.  Culturally diverse meals and snacks are included in our seasonal menu. Taste buds will be delighted with the way our food is flavoured using a wide selection of herbs and spices; cumin, coriander, curry powder, basil, parsley (some selected from our very own herb garden.)

All our meals are prepared daily on premises by our qualified chef using in season ingredients delivered fresh by our various suppliers. Children enjoy a variety of meals including Spaghetti Bolognese, Vegetable Soup, Lasagne, Meat and Vegetable Curries, Chilli con Carne, Tuna Pasta Bake, Shepherd’s Pie and many more. Water is consistently available for children throughout the day and with every meal.

We also provide snack times where in season fruit is offered accompanied with a selection of; muffins, crumpets, crackers and cheese, dips, raisin toast etc.

To assist with growing our vegetable patches and herb garden we have a compost bin on premises, children assist with placing scraps in the bin, turning it and pouring the beautiful dirt onto our garden. We also have a worm farm that children also assist with the maintenance of.

Our chef has completed certificate 4 in hospitality (commercial cookery) and has also attended many professional development sessions in serving/preparing meals for children.  In 2015 our menu and range of meals was assessed and approved by Healthy Eating Australia.
